9th Annual Baton Rouge Soul Food Festival Announces Talent Lineup, Contests and Sponsors
EntSun News/11090570
BATON ROUGE, La. - EntSun -- The 9th Annual Baton Rouge Soul Food Festival announces talent lineup, contests and sponsors. The event is May 23 and 24 at the East Baton Rouge Parish Library – Main Library, 7711 Goodwood Boulevard, Baton Rouge, LA 70806, from 11:00am to 8:00pm daily and is free to the public. It features blues, soul, R&B, jazz, gospel and Christian music, a Vendor's Village, judged Soul Food Cooking Contest and Mustard Greens and Cornbread Eating Contest.
The stage lineup includes Henry Turner Jr. & Flavor and the Listening Room All-stars including Ervin "Maestro" Foster and the My Better Half Band, King Solomon, Kelton 'Nspire Harper and Pastor Leon Hitchens.
Saturday's talent opens with bluesman Adam Gabriel, Susie Shepherd, the Phoenix Rouge Dance Troupe and Christian rapper Stephen King. New to the festival is the Blue-eyed soul Shadow Road Band and Christian singer Karly Monday. Carlo Ditta joins with New Orleans R&B, followed by jazz instrumentalist Rodney Gipson. Closing Saturdays' schedule is old school R&B band LA Grove.

Sunday's lineup is southern soul singers Ms. Pressure and Mister Cotton, who is new to the festival this year. Christian singer Xavie Shorts is followed by the House of God Praise Team and Lisa Harris returns to the festival with her Tina Turner Tribute. Soul singer Uncle Chess ts followed by Poet Sir AP and Christian singer Princess Teha. Closing the festival is Eilene Rockette with the House of God Church Healing and Deliverance Youth Dance Praise Team. Hosts are Free Spirit, Kerwin Fealing and Princess Teha with DJ Olu.
The Soul Food Cooking Competition is open until May 15. Categories are Meats, Vegetable and Side Dishes with judging on Saturday; and Breads and Desserts, Appetizers and Soups, Beverage judged on Sunday. Criteria includes Presentation, Taste, and the Story or History behind each dish. First, second and third place prizes will be awarded. The Mustard Greens and Cornbread Eating Contest is Saturday. Downloadable forms are available on the website. For more information on the contest, VIP packages and talent lineup call 225-802-9681 or visit https://www.brsoulfoodfest.com.

Festival discounts include two dollar bowls of Pork and Beans with wieners both days and two dollar shots of Boone's Farms Strawberry Hill Wine on Saturday.
Sponsors for the festival are Visit Baton Rouge, WBRZ Television, Ch. 2, and their affiliate stations, East Baton Rouge Parish Libraries, Blue Runner, Thomas Law Firm, Joyful Jumps, Cutting Edge CE Conference and Henry Turner Jr.'s Listening Room Museum Foundation.
The Pre-Party is Thursday, May 21 at Henry Turner Jr.'s Listening Room located at 2733 North Street, Baton Rouge, LA 70802, from 7:00pm midnight. Donation is $30.00 and includes a Soul Food buffet and no-host bar.
